Bonjour,
J'essaye d'installer Piwigo sur un Synology DS212 dans le dossier web de File Station :
J'ai donc "dézippé" le dossier piwigo dans un dossier portant le même nom dans ce dossier "web".
Lorsque je me connecte via le navigateur pour faire l'installation , j'obtiens une page blanche...
pour l'installation j'ai été sur htpp://192.168.1.xx/piwigo/install.php :
- page blanche sans message d'erreur !
- J'avais d'abord créer ma base de donnée avec phpMyAdmin.
- Vérifié les autorisations fichiers/dossiers.
Où est l'erreur ?
Merci de votre aide !
Version de Piwigo:
Version de PHP: 7.4
Version de MySQL: Maria DB 10
URL Piwigo: http://
Dernière modification par diaph (2025-08-01 19:13:18)
Hors ligne
Bonjour,
J'ignore comment est configuré Apache sur du DSM mais il y a peut-être à voir de ce côté.
À tout hasard, as-tu suivi ce tuto ? https://www.nas-forum.com/forum/topic/7 … o-station/
C'est du php8 mais ça ne devrait pas être un problème.
Hors ligne
Oui, j'ai lu ce tuto avant l'installation, mais mon Synology est en DSM 6.2.
J'ai quand même procéder à la même procédure que le DSM 7 du tuto : à part quelques différences, car le 6.2 n'a pas la même procédure ni les mêmes fonctions.
Bref, j'ai certainement fait une erreur, mais je ne sais pas où...
Hors ligne
Je dirais déjà de faire des vérifs :
- l'accès à apache : http://192.168.1.xx avec le xx du nas,
- ce que raconte phpinfo, rien d'anormal ? : http://192.168.1.xx/phpinfo.php
- placer une page minimale de test dans le dossier web et voir si tu y accèdes.
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d"> <html xmlns="http://www.w3.org/1999/xhtml"> <head> <meta http-equiv="Content-Type" content="text/html; charset=utf-8" /> <title>test en html</title> </head> <body> <div>Page test.html</div> </body> </html>
Hors ligne
phpinfo s'affiche ; PHP Version 7.4.30
En revanche, je ne sais pas si une config n'est pas bonne ! Je ne m'y connaît pas.
J'ai mis la page test dans le dossier /piwigo/ : elle est visible...
Dernière modification par diaph (2025-07-29 19:20:29)
Hors ligne
Encore autre chose : Nounours18200 a eu un problème sur l'archive téléchargée, voir https://fr.piwigo.org/forum/viewtopic.p … 70#p241970
Peux-tu donner le lien vers l'archive que tu as utilisée ?
Hors ligne
Bonsoir @diaph
C'est moi qui ai écrit le tuto sur nas_forum, la 1ère fois en 2023 j'étais en DSM 6.2, ça fonctionnait.
Concernant le répertoire d'installation tu crées un répertoire avec le nom de ton site photo dans /volume1/web/ , par exemple : /volume1/web/photodiaph
Tu dézippes piwigo sur ton ordi et tu copies le contenu de piwigo ( pas piwigo ) dans photodiaph
Ce qui bloque souvent c'est les droits sur les fichiers, le plus simple c'est de donner les droits en lecture et en écriture à l'utilisateur SYSTEM sur tout le répertoire 'photodiaph'
Pour pouvoir utiliser webstation il faut avoir installé phpmyadmin avec mariadb, php 8 et apache 2.4
Après il faut activer le site web dans webstation (c'est là où il y une différence entre DSM 6.2 et DSM 7 )
Dans statut tu dois avoir :
Etat du serveur par défaut : normal
Etat du portail de service web : normal
apache 2.4 : normal
php 8.0 : normal
1 - dans 'paramètre du langage de script' créer un profil php, nom du profil 'piwigo', description 'piwigo', version php : PHP 8.0, dans l'onglet 'Extensions' activer exif, gd, imagick, mysql, openssl, zip, zlib
2 - dans portail de service web, créer un virtual host, basé sur le nom : photodiaph,
configurer une hote virtuel ;
racine du document : /volume1/web/photodiaph
serveur principal : apache 2.4
paramètre de langage de script , PHP : piwigo ( créé en 1 )
valider
Pour lancer l'installation de piwgo, saisir dans le navigateur '192.168.1.xx/photodiaph' où xx est l'adresse du NAS dans ton réseau local, et tu dois arriver sur la page de configuration de piwigo ( suite sur le tuto )
L'ordre est important :
- par exemple, si tu lances le site, donc l'installation de piwigo, avant d'avoir défini les droits d'écriture sur les répertoires ça va planter
- si tu configure l'hôte virtuel sans avoir défini le profil php, il va le faire avec un php standard qui ne connait pas 'mysql' et la base de données ne sera pas créee.
On ne doit pas créer la base de données pour piwigo sur phpmyadmin, c'est l'installateur piwigo qui va le faire.
Bon courage, mais ça doit fonctionner !!
EDIT du 30/07/2025
Oups !! ce que je décris ci-dessus c'est pour DSM 7.1 , mais en DSM 6 c'est pas très différent :
- quand tu crées le script php les options ne sont pas dans un onglet mais en fin de page
- dans webstation il y a 'paramètres généraux' où il faut vérifier que tu est bien en apache avec le script php piwigo
Dernière modification par Charles69 (2025-07-30 10:37:22)
Hors ligne
- J'ai réinstallé une nouvelle archive (téléchargée sur le site piwigo) dans mon dossier "photodiaph" en suivant strictement les indications de Charles69.
- Résultat : page blanche !
...Mystère...
Dans le dosssier "photodiaph" j'ai mis le fichier phpinfo.php, et il s'affiche normalement... Donc, ma config doit être bonne : il y a peut-être un soucis du côté de l'install qui ne trouve pas MariaDB ?
Dernière modification par diaph (2025-07-30 09:07:07)
Hors ligne
Bonjour
tu as bien décompressé l'archiive sur ton ordinateur avant le transfert sur le nas ?
Hors ligne
Bonjour à tous,
Premier essai avec l'archive 15.6 et deuxième essai avec la 12.3.0 toute deux décompressée sur mon ordi.
Je vais refaire encore une autre tentative... avec la 15.6 en repartant d'une autre archive toute neuve... Va ben falloir que ça fonctionne, quand même !...
C'est pas fini, mais je vous remercie de votre aide et disponibilité...
Hors ligne
Bonjour @diaph
diaph a écrit:
J'ai réinstallé une nouvelle archive (téléchargée sur le site piwigo) dans mon dossier "photodiaph" en suivant strictement les indications de Charles69.
- Résultat : page blanche !
Qu'est ce que tu entends par 'page blanche' ?
Dans File Station tu devrais voir ça :
et après avoir configuré Web Station, en saisissant :
192.168.1.xx/photodiaph ou 192.168.1.xx/photodiaph/install
tu devrais voir ça
Dernière modification par Charles69 (2025-07-30 12:24:09)
Hors ligne
Bonjour,
J'ai refais un autre dossier avec piwigo 15.6.0
J'ai bien vérifié que mes dossiers soit en chmod 777
et... j'ai le message : une erreur est survenue
Donnez les droits en écriture (chmod 777) sur le répertoire "_data/" à la racine de votre installation Piwigo
alors que mes droits sont en 777 !!! Grrrrr
Mais je n'ai plus ma page blanche ! ça progresse !
Dernière modification par diaph (2025-07-30 22:28:19)
Hors ligne